How The Resin Layer Process Really Works From Start To Finish
Initially, preparing the raw surface takes up almost all the real work time. For example, floor technicians grind the old surface using heavy diamond disks to scratch up the concrete. That way, the sticky bottom layer can grab on like crazy. Otherwise, cheap stick-on solutions just peel up as soon as your hot car tires touch them!
Next, fixing those ugly structural floor cracks happens before any top liquid drops down. So, thick filler pastes go straight into those annoying deep holes to smooth everything out. Subsequently, the base liquid layer gets mixed up real fast with a special hardener tool. After that, the liquid pours out smooth across your whole room… dynamic timing is super important here because it hardens fast!
Finally, decorative color chips get thrown into the air to cover the whole sticky base. Eventually, a crystal clear top coat seals those colored flakes down rock hard. Because of that finish, your heavy toolbox carts roll super smooth without chipping the floor.

Property owners in Newtown, Missouri usually call after looking at a bare concrete slab that is dusting, staining, or simply old. Epoxy floor coating is a multi-coat resin system applied directly over a prepared slab. The chemistry bonds at a molecular level with the concrete and cures into a rigid, chemical-resistant surface several times harder than the slab beneath.
Most modern systems are 80 to 100 mil thick once cured. The visual hallmark is a glossy mirror finish, often with decorative flake or metallic. Beyond the look, the slab is now sealed: motor oil, brake fluid, road salt and acid spills wipe off instead of soaking in.

How much does epoxy flooring cost in Newtown, Missouri?
Residential garages typically run $4 to $10 per square foot installed, depending on finish complexity and prep needed. A two-car garage usually lands between $1,800 and $4,500. The phone quote is firm before any deposit is taken.
How long does the coating last?
A properly prepped professional-grade install lasts 15 to 25 years in residential garage use. heavy-traffic floors are warrantied for 10 years. The 5-year written warranty covers adhesion and chip-out from the slab.

How long until I can park on it?
Foot traffic in 24 hours, full vehicle traffic at 72 hours. Hot-tire pickup is not a concern with professional-grade resins.
